In non-profit organizations, the source of revenue is severely limited - to charitable donations, governmental funding, etc. Because of this limitation, funding the activities of the organization is very difficult, especially if they have adopted a poorly thought out strategy and thus end up wasting a significant portion of their funds. Most non-profit organizations already know what they will be doing, but they need to decide what steps they will take, and how best to take those steps. Thus they still have the majority of what is important in strategic planning (the only part not needed is discussion about what their goal is in general).
